About this Event
This creative workshop draws on ongoing research into fatness and the archive, which explores how histories of fat lives, bodies and fat activism are produced, obscured and reimagined through curation. Using examples of images of fat people and archive descriptions sourced from online catalogues, we will explore patterns of representation and reflect upon the power of language in shaping historical meaning and social norms. We will then creatively re-imagine how images are described by creating liberatory alternative descriptions, informed by lived experience and affective connections with the past.
Please note: There will be some discussion of ongoing discrimination and historical derogatory presentation of fat and disabled people. Historical images of fat people also involve nudity. Therefore, we recommend attendees be 16+.
